What is GE Legal?

GE Legal professionals are attorneys and legal experts who work within General Electric (GE) to advise the company on legal matters, ensure regulatory compliance, manage contracts, handle litigation, and support business operations. They play a crucial role in mitigating risks, navigating complex legal environments, and upholding ethical standards. Their work covers a broad range of legal areas, including corporate law, intellectual property, employment law, and mergers and acquisitions.

What are the typical collaboration dynamics between the GE Legal team and other departments within the company?

In a GE Legal role, you'll frequently collaborate with colleagues from departments such as compliance, finance, human resources, and operations to ensure business activities meet legal and regulatory standards. Legal professionals are often involved early in project planning to identify potential risks, draft and review contracts, and provide guidance on regulatory requirements. You'll likely participate in cross-functional meetings and work closely with business leaders to align legal strategies with company objectives. This collaborative environment provides valuable exposure to various aspects of the business and can open pathways for career advancement within GE.

What is the difference between Ge Legal vs Ge Paralegal?

AspectGe LegalGe Paralegal
CredentialsLaw degree, bar admissionParalegal certificate or associate degree
Work EnvironmentLaw firms, corporate legal departmentsLegal offices, corporate settings
Job ResponsibilitiesLegal research, advising, drafting legal documentsAssisting attorneys, preparing documents, research support

Ge Legal professionals typically hold law degrees and are licensed to practice law, handling complex legal tasks. Ge Paralegals support attorneys with research and document preparation but do not require a law license. Both roles work in legal environments, but Ge Legal roles involve more advanced legal responsibilities and credentials.

Job description

Job Description Summary
As the AI Catalyst Leader for Unison (GE Aerospace), you will bridge the gap between cutting-edge data science and world-class aerospace product and service delivery. Reporting to the CDIO of GE Aerospace and the GM of the Unison, you won't just build models-you'll be a leader in a high-performing team to embed AI directly into our shop floors and customer offerings. This is a high-impact, gemba-focused role designed to revolutionize aerospace productivity through Lean principles and intelligent automation.
Job Description
Key Responsibilities
  • Strategic Execution: Lead the AI/ML product strategy across Unison, turning complex business needs into data-driven solutions that optimize SQDC (Safety, Quality, Delivery, and Cost) that align with both business need and enterprise framework.
  • Team Leadership: Build and mentor a premier data and AI applications team, fostering a culture of innovation and continuous improvement.
  • Operational Integration: Partner with shop operations to deploy AI tools that reduce downtime, improve engine service outcomes, and enhance profitability.
  • Lean Transformation: Act as a Lean practitioner, applying "Flight Deck" behaviors to standardize technology delivery and drive business transformation.
  • Genba Presence: Spend ~40% of your time on-site at Unison facilities to understand the user experience firsthand and ensure technology solves real-world shop problems.

Minimum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ree with 10+ years of professional experience (or equivalent years of experience/Military service).
  • 7+ years of dedicated experience in Data Analytics/Engineering leadership.
  • Note: Military experience is equivalent to professional experience

Eligibility Requirement:
  • Legal authorization to work in the U.S. is required. We will not sponsor individuals for employment visas, now or in the future, for this job.

The Ideal Candidate
  • Tech-Savy Strategist: Deep knowledge of DT operations and the ability to translate "shop talk" into analytical problem statements.
  • Lean Champion: Experience coaching others in Lean behaviors and applying them to digital workflows.
  • Influential Communicator: Confident interfacing with senior leadership and global teams to drive organizational change.
  • Customer-First Mindset: A track record of evaluating decisions through the eyes of the customer to ensure high-impact results.
